Table 1.

Descriptive Statistics for Continuous Covariates and Alcohol Use Outcomes (Quantity of Use Among Users)

Variable M SD Skewness Kurtosis α
Activity level (Time1) 1.40 0.71 0.14 −0.48 .71
Approach (Time 1) 1.63 0.67 −0.18 −0.17 .66
Social problems (Time 1) 0.35 0.34 1.28 1.52 .69
Self-worth (Time 1) 4.62 0.90 −0.71 0.23 .77
Ethanol in grams/10
 Time 1 2.19 1.56 0.99 0.20
 Time 2 2.50 2.31 1.07 0.67
 Time 3 3.29 2.82 1.11 0.92
 Time 4 4.94 3.79 0.88 −0.02

Note. Observed means for ethanol in grams/10 were computed for those using alcohol at the current time point and having no missing data, resulting in the following sample sizes: Time 1, n = 602; Time 2, n = 555; Time 3, n = 592; Time 4, n = 659. Observed means for covariates are based on the full sample (N = 1,484).
